The Trauma and Attachment Belief Scale (TABS) is an 84-item self-report measure that assesses long-term impact of trauma, helping clinicians design effective individualised treatment plans.
The TABS assesses beliefs-about self and others-that are related to five needs commonly affected by traumatic experience (safety, trust, esteem, intimacy, control). For each of these dimensions, the TABS produces 10 scale scores reflecting "beliefs about self" and "beliefs about others." A Total Score is also provided.
The TABS Manual is split into two parts, providing information on:
Part I: Administration, Scoring and Interpretation Guide
Part II: Technical Guide
